Special Abilities
Arcane Magic
Magical Research: May spend time and money on magical research, enabling the Illusionist to add new spells to their book and research other magical effects. At 9th level, they become able to create magical items. Research and artifice must be within the purview of illusion magic, as determined by the Referee.
Spell Casting: Illusionists cast Illusionist spells. At 1st level, they know one 1st level spell, and may cast one 1st level spell.
Using Magic Items: Illusionists are able to cast spells from spell scrolls that deal in illusion magic, and are on their spell list; they are also able to use magical items usable by arcane spell casters, although those that deal direct damage, such as wands of fire balls and scrolls of Delsenora's Malevolent Steamroller are not.
Combat
Illusionists are able to wield daggers alone, and staves if the Referee feels like allowing that!
